Introduction

Silicone baking mats have become indispensable tools in the kitchen, offering a plethora of benefits for both home bakers and professionals alike. Their non-stick properties, durability, and reusability make them a convenient and cost-effective alternative to traditional parchment paper. However, their impact on baking time and temperature has been a subject of debate, with some claiming they can significantly alter the outcome of baking. This article delves into the research on the impact of silicone baking mats on baking time and temperature, exploring the various factors that influence their effects.

Influence of Baking Method

The impact of silicone baking mats on baking time and temperature can also vary depending on the baking method used. For convection baking, which circulates hot air around the food, silicone mats may have a lesser effect on baking time as the air circulation promotes even heating. In contrast, for conventional baking, where heat is transferred primarily through conduction, silicone mats can play a more significant role in reducing baking time and temperature.
